Finished Goods Planning & Inventory Management: Plan warehouse replenishment by coordinating with feeder factories and suppliers to meet customer fulfillment targets while maintaining optimal inventory levels.
Procurement & Supplier Performance: Execute the procurement cycle from requisition to purchase order, confirm deliveries, monitor supplier performance, and resolve issues to ensure timely and accurate fulfillment.
Analytics & Continuous Improvement: Analyze planning and fulfillment metrics (e.g., inventory shortages, on time delivery misses, inventory days on hand) to optimize inventory levels, reduce excess/obsolete stock, and drive cross-functional improvements with sales, marketing, and suppliers.
Reporting & Process Control: Maintain planning parameters, run inventory control reports, manage exceptions, lead weekly pacing meetings, and drive initiatives to improve supplier performance and resolve non-performance root causes.
Bachelor's degree in Materials/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, or related field with 5+ years relevant work experience (Materials Planning, Sourcing and/or Logistics, preferred). Will consider an Associate's degree in Materials/Supply Chain Management, Business Administration or related field with 7+ years relevant work experience OR High School Diploma/GED with 10+ years of relevant work experience.
Advanced knowledge of integrated ERP systems, specifically SAP.
APICS / ISM or equal supply chain certifications preferred.
Demonstrated analytical skills, ability to achieve results with minimal supervision.
Strong time management and organization skills.
Clear communication and presentation skills.
Proficiency in MS Excel required and Power BI is a plus.
